Kettering 3-0 Ebbsfleet

Moses Ashikodi
Kettering striker Moses Ashikodi hit his fourth goal of the season

Kettering lifted themselves up to second place in the Blue Square Premier with their third successive home win.

Greg Taylor set up Moses Ashikodi to hammer the Poppies' first-half opener into the top left corner.

Danny Thomas then set up Francis Green for the clinching second 13 minutes from time.

And a Leon Crooks own goal proved to be the icing on the cake for Kettering, enabling them to leapfrog above Stevenage in the table.


Kettering: Harper, Eaden, Dempster, Roper, Taylor, Thomas, Noubissie, Fowler, Carayol (Jennings 64), Green (Geohaghon 83), Ashikodi (Marna 69).
Subs Not Used: Wrack, Spencer.

Goal: Ashikodi (34), Green (77), Crooks (87).

Booked: Ashikodi.

Ebbsfleet: Cronin, Salmon (Heeroo 63), McCarthy, Crooks, Charles, Wills, Shakes, Bailey, Welsh, Vieira (Ginty 78), Cumbers.
Subs Not Used: Lamprell, Pooley, Shulton.

Booked: Shakes, Welsh, Bailey.

Referee: Wayne Barratt (Halesowen).

Attendance: 1,345.
